CVE-2009-2507 is a vulnerability of currently unknown severity. A certain ActiveX control in the Indexing Service in Microsoft Windows 2000 SP4, XP SP2 and SP3, and Server 2003 SP2 does not properly process URLs, which allows remote attackers to execute arbitrary programs via unspecified vectors that cause a "vulnerable binary" to load and run, aka "Memory Corruption in Indexing Service Vulnerability.". EPSS estimates a 19.29% chance of exploitation in the next 30 days.
